原文:開窗函數 --over()

一個學習性任務:每個人有不同次數的成績,統計出每個人的最高成績。 這個問題應該還是相對簡單,其實就用聚合函數就好了。 select id,name,max score from Student group by id,name order by name 上邊這種情況只適用id 和name是一一對應的,否則查詢出來的數據是不正確的。 例如 : 張三 張三 查詢出來的結果 兩條信息都會輸出。 避免這 ...

2016-08-26 09:19 0 4775 推薦指數:

查看詳情

Oracle開窗函數 over()(轉)

copy文鏈接:http://blog.csdn.net/yjjm1990/article/details/7524167#,http://www.2cto.com/database/201402/281473.html 格式:   可以開窗函數(..) over ...

Thu Dec 29 07:56:00 CST 2016 0 2690
開窗函數 over 和分組函數和分析函數

首先說明mysql 8.0 以前不支持,oracle hive 支持 先說說分組, sql 里面 使用 group by 分組,分組以后會吧分組的 值相等的幾行放到一行。行數變少。 ...

Tue Jun 22 00:57:00 CST 2021 0 182
Oracle常用函數--over()開窗函數

返回一個統計值,只有一行,而分析函數采用partition by分組,每組中包含多個值。   開窗函數 ...

Fri May 22 17:29:00 CST 2020 0 948
oracle之分析函數over開窗函數

一:分析函數overOracle從8.1.6開始提供分析函數,分析函數用於計算基於組的某種聚合值,它和聚合函數的不同之處是對於每個組返回多行,而聚合函數對於每個組只返回一行。 統計各班成績第一名的同學信息NAME CLASS S ...

Wed Dec 28 23:45:00 CST 2011 0 12380
sql開窗函數_累計求和開窗函數sum()over()

需求:有如下示例數據,其中PRODUCT表示產品,CONTRACT_MOUTH表示合同月份,AMOUNT表示當月合同金額,請求出每個產品累計合同金額。 比如牛奶2月份累計求和金額為100+200=3 ...

Sat Jun 05 01:52:00 CST 2021 0 3331
Sql server 開窗函數over()的語法

用法一:與ROW_NUMBER()函數結合用,給結果進行排序編號,如圖: 代碼如下: View Code 用法二:跟聚合函數一起使用,利用over子句的分組效率比group by子句的效率更高。 在Northwind數據庫的訂單表 ...

Fri Mar 18 00:54:00 CST 2016 2 12566
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M